Key facts from Sterling Village Second Plat's documents

Reflects the 2023 governing documents — figures and rules are as originally recorded and may have changed since.

Community type
Townhomes of Harvard Homeowners Association Inc. (Recitals (page 1))
Legal name
Townhomes of Harvard Homeowners Association Inc.
Units / lots
13 (Lots 4 through 16 inclusive) (Recitals (page 1) and Exhibit A (page 16)
Developer / declarant
SBD Capital Development LLC, a Missouri Limited Liability Company (Recitals (page 1))
Assessments & dues
Initial regular assessment: $200.00 per building (4 units) per month (Article IV §4.04(a) (page 8))
Special assessments
Special Group Assessments for capital improvements, unexpected repairs, etc. Must be approved by Members per §§2.02-2.03. (Article IV §4.05 (page 8))
Collections & liens
Unpaid assessments + interest + late charges + collection costs (including attorney's fees) become a continuing lien on the Lot, subordinate to first deed of trust. Foreclosure may commence 180 days past original due date if unpaid. (Article IV §4.02 and §4.02(b) (page 7))
Reserves & fees
Board may establish reserve funds, maintained separately from operating funds; may create separate irrevocable trust accounts. (Article III §3.04 (page 6))
Pets
Household pets allowed, not to exceed three in number. (Article VI §6.11 (page 12))
Leasing & rentals
Leasing of all or part of any Residence for less than six months is expressly prohibited, including short term vacation rentals without owner/lessee presence. (Article VI §6.16 (page 12))
Parking & vehicles
No boat, truck, trailer, camper, recreational vehicle, bus, unlicensed vehicle, or commercial vehicle shall be parked on Lots or streets, except incidental to construction/repair. Building materials/machinery/equipment not permitted except (Article VI §6.12 (page 12))
Fences
Fences must be unpainted wood, aluminum, or wrought iron; height not exceed 72 inches; must not extend closer to street than front of house; must have written ARC approval. (Article VI §6.06 (page 11))
Architectural approval
Before any structure or improvement is built, altered, or placed on any Lot, plans, specifications, location, elevations must be submitted to and have written approval of Architectural Review Committee. Includes fences, walkways, driveways, (Article VII §7.02 (page 13))
Solar & roof
Roofing material must be permanent type (no rolled roofing). Color and material must be approved in writing by ARC. Exterior colors and materials must be approved by ARC. No paint on vinyl siding. (Article VI §6.03-6.04 (page 10))
Home business
No commercial business, enterprise or trade; office work by Owner(s) permitted. (Article VI §6.01 (page 10))
Signs & flags
No signs visible from streets/adjoining lots/Common Properties except: real estate signs (two 5 sq ft per lot during initial construction, one Realtor's for-sale sign ≤5 sq ft, small security system signs); Declarant may maintain billboards (Article VI §6.07 and subparts (a)(c)(d) )
Setbacks / home size
No part of residence nearer to front or side street than building line shown on plat; no more than 15 feet further from street than building line. Side lot setback: no house closer than 4 feet to side lot line or as required by City ordinan (Article VI §6.05 and §6.05(b) (page 10-1)
Maintenance
Exterior maintenance (including roof?) by Owner; if fails, Association may repair and assess. Roof materials subject to ARC approval. Specific roof responsibility not delineated. (Article V §5.05 (page 10); Article VI §6)
Insurance
Association may carry insurance on Common Properties; no specific master policy coverage described. (Article III §3.01(b) (page 4); Article I)
Use restrictions
All Lots shall be used for residential purposes only. No commercial business, enterprise or trade, except office work by Owner(s). (Article VI §6.01 (page 10))
Voting & meetings
Class A (owners): one vote per Lot; Class B (Declarant): six votes per Lot owned. Declarant must consent to any action until earlier of (a) no longer owns any Lot or lien interest and no adjoining acreage to develop, or (b) January 1, 2037. (Article II §§2.02, 2.03 (pages 3-4))
Amendments
Covenants may be amended with consent of Association and 66% of Owner members, by written document recorded in Jackson County, Missouri. Exception: Section 8.03 refers to itself? Actually Article VIII §8.03 says 'except as provided in Secti (Article VIII §8.03 (page 14))
